問題タブ [obshapedbutton]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
4 に答える
825 参照

iphone - プログラムで CircleImage に UIButton を作成する

円形の画像にアーチ型の を作成する必要がありUIButtonsます (O/p は同心円のように見える必要があります)。

現在、私は 5 つの画像を使用していますが、将来的にはさらに画像を追加する可能性があります。追加した画像で円の画像を動的に塗りつぶす必要があります。

サンプルのコードがあり、O/P は下の画像です

上記のコードの画像

このコードを試してみましたが、O/P は下の画像です

2枚目の画像

下の画像のような出力が必要です 3枚目の画像

どうすればそれを達成できますか

サラ・ズオのコードで試した後のO/P

サラ・ズオ・コード

同じ幅と高さSarah Zuo コード 2 番目の回答
のボタン

0 投票する
1 に答える
149 参照

ios - ストーリーボードのOBShapedButtonクラス

iOSプロジェクトにOBShapedButtonクラスを実装しようとしています。これにより、pngファイルで定義された不規則な形状のボタンを作成できます。これは、OBShapedButtonの詳細についてのリンクです。

基本的に、このクラスは、nibファイルで使用するときにうまく機能します。ただし、プロジェクトではストーリーボードを使用することを好みます。しかし、ストーリーボードで同じことをしようとすると、ペン先ファイルで行うのと同じ不規則なボタンを作成するためのすべての手順に従って、それは機能せず、クリック可能な領域は、png画像ではなく長方形によって定義されます。

私の質問は、OBShapedButtonでストーリーボードをどのように使用するのかということです。OBShapedButtonが機能しなくなるストーリーボードについて私が見逃しているものはありますか?